How much do 3rd shift machine operator j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for 3rd shift machine operator in Kansas is $16.39,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.57 and $17.60 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by 3rd Shift Machine Operators and how can they be managed?

3rd Shift Machine Operators often encounter challenges such as maintaining focus during overnight hours, managing fatigue, and adapting to a quieter or less supervised work environment. To overcome these, it’s important to establish a consistent sleep schedule, stay hydrated, and take advantage of scheduled breaks to prevent burnout. Operators are encouraged to communicate regularly with team members across shifts to ensure seamless handovers and address any issues that arise. Many companies offer shift differentials and support programs to help 3rd shift workers manage these challenges effectively.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a 3rd Shift Machine Operator, and why are they important?

To thrive as a 3rd Shift Machine Operator, you need mechanical aptitude, attention to detail, and a high school diploma or equivalent, often with prior manufacturing experience. Familiarity with industrial machinery, safety protocols, and often basic computer systems or machine interface panels is expected. Reliability, problem-solving, and the ability to work independently during overnight hours are important soft skills. These skills ensure safe, efficient operation of equipment, minimal downtime, and consistent production quality during less supervised shifts.

What are 3rd Shift Machine Operators?

3rd Shift Machine Operators are employees who operate and monitor machinery during the overnight or late-night shift, typically from late evening to early morning. Their responsibilities include setting up machines, performing routine maintenance, ensuring quality control, and troubleshooting equipment issues. Working the third shift often requires attention to safety protocols, the ability to work independently, and adaptability to a nighttime work schedule. These roles are common in manufacturing, warehouse, and production environments where operations run 24/7.

Job description

Hiring Machine Operators (Full time, no part time positions available) in Lawrence, KS
Pay Rate: $22.43 / hour (+ shift differential if applicable)
Shift options:
  • 1st shift: 7am - 3pm.
  • 2nd shift: 3pm - 11pm ($1.00 shift diff.)
  • 3rd shift: 11pm - 7am ($1.50 shift diff.)

All contractors will need to train on the 1st shift before moving to 2nd or 3rd shift:
  • 1 - 3 years mechanical and/or manufacturing experience.
  • Forklift operating experience preferred.

Job Summary:
Conducts routine and non-routine phases of the manufacture of electrical submersible petroleum pump cable and/or rubber molded products.
Key Functions:
  • Qualified to set up and operate specific work center, work center equipment and/or tasks under normal supervision.
  • Monitors assigned equipment and performs adjustments as needed.
  • Communicates effectively to all levels of the organization.
  • Attention to detail in documentation and process tasks.
  • Understand safe work practices and apply them accordingly.
  • Good general fitness with the ability to lift 10 – 50 lbs. as needed.
  • Ability to use measuring instruments and understand specifications.
  • Decision making skills on product quality based on specifications and visual observations.
  • Ability and willingness to work all 3 shifts, rotate shifts and work overtime.
  • Records necessary data and as well as performs computer input and retrieval completely and accurately.
  • Works independently of others as well as with team members, area managers, and support personnel.
  • Assists with work center inventories.
  • Uses participative team management style.
  • Ability to stand for long periods of time.
  • Wear PPE, as required, and observe health, safety, and environmental policies.
  • Successfully complete required safety training (including but not limited to forklift, drug and alcohol, electrical, emergency response, fire, first aid, health and hygiene, PPE, SIPP, risk reporting, IT security, hazardous materials, driving)
